> So yeah, let's work towards having a single Node Profile (flavor)
> associated with each Deployment Role (pages 12 & 13 of the latest
> mockups[1]), optionally starting with requiring all the Node Profiles to
> be equal.
I think here is a small misinterpretation. All Node Profiles don't have 
to be equal. We just support one Node Profile association per role.

> Once that's working fine, we can look into the harder case of having
> multiple Node Profiles within a Deployment Role.
